Главная » Java » Отладка

0

 

   В составе класса Runtime определены два метода (они описаны ниже), ориентированных на использование в процессе отладки (debugging) приложений.

 public void traceinstructions(boolean on)

Разрешает или запрещает трассировку (tracing) инструкций кода в зависимости от значения булевого флага on. Если значение on равно true, метод предлагает виртуальной машине воспроизводить отладочную информацию для каждой инструкции кода по мере ее выполнения.

public void traceMethodCalls(boolean on)

Разрешает или запрещает трассировку вызовов методов в зависимости от значения булевого флага on. Если значение on равно true, метод предлагает виртуальной машине воспроизводить отладочную информацию для каждого вызова метода по мере его выполнения.

  Формат представления отладочной информации и адрес ее назначения — наименование файла или потока вывода, куда она направляется, — зависят от параметров среды, в которой выполняется программа. Каждая виртуальная машина свободна в выборе того, что и как делать с отладочной информацией, — последняя может вообще не выводиться, если локальная исполняющая система не обладает соответствующими инструментами, хотя в интегрированных средах разработки Java-приложений таковые обычно поддерживаются.

 

Источник: Арнолд, Кен, Гослинг, Джеймс, Холмс, Дэвид. Язык программирования Java. 3-е изд .. : Пер. с англ. – М. : Издательский дом «Вильяме», 2001. – 624 с. : ил. – Парал. тит. англ.

По теме:

  • Комментарии